Description:  Italy, Livorno, Via Roma 234, Villa Webb Henderson. It was the villa of James Webb, a rich English merchant, who died in 1822 and the villa passed to the family Guebhard. In 1850 the title of succession went to Mrs. Webb James widow of Giovanni Gherarducci and in 1890 to Webb James Elisa and Gherarducci Elvira. The property was sold in 1900 to Bracchini Ettore and on August 7, 1917 to Peterson Costance wife of Giorgio Henderson. Henderson’s widow sold the villa in 1935 to the Provincial administration which transformed it into a Museum of Natural History of the Mediterranean Sea.
